Adapting and Succession Planning with Neil Russell

Neil Russell is the chairman of PJ Care, a family-run specialist neurocare provider, which has been recognised as a Diversity and Inclusion champion and a Top 10 Health and Social Care company to work for in the UK. Neil draws his experience from a varied background, which includes being a diplomat for the British Foreign and Commonwealth Office.

Tune in as we unpack the importance of maintaining the founder's ideals and ethos, developing diversity at a senior level, and how to best learn from constructive criticism. Russell also shares his ambitions of making PJ Care the top neurocare provider in the world.
